Chicken Wing Meat and Skin (Raw)
SR Legacy·Comprehensive Reference DataStandard Reference Legacy database is a comprehensive compilation of nutrient data maintained by the USDA. It covers a wide range of foods with reliable reference values.Chicken, broilers or fryers, wing, meat and skin, raw
Poultry Products
Macronutrients distribute relatively evenly across protein (17.5g), fat (12.8g), and carbohydrates (0g) per 100g. At 191 calories per 100g, Chicken Wing Meat and Skin (Raw) offers moderate energy density suitable for balanced meals. Sodium is modest at 84mg per 100g, well within limits for heart-healthy eating patterns. Nutritionally broad, Chicken Wing Meat and Skin (Raw) delivers meaningful amounts of 11 different vitamins and minerals above 10% of daily value. Contains 111mg of cholesterol per 100g (37% DV), which may matter for individuals actively managing cholesterol.

Nutrition Facts per 100g
| Water | 69.2 | G |
| Energy | 191 | KCAL |
| Protein | 17.5 | G |
| Total lipid (fat) | 12.8 | G |
| Carbohydrate, by difference | 0 | G |
| Fiber, total dietary | 0 | G |
| Total Sugars | 0 | G |
| Cholesterol | 111 | MG |
| Vitamin C, total ascorbic acid | 0 | MG |
| Thiamin | 0.05 | MG |
| Riboflavin | 0.10 | MG |
| Niacin | 5.7 | MG |
| Vitamin B-6 | 0.53 | MG |
| Folate, total | 7.0 | UG |
| Vitamin B-12 | 0.25 | UG |
| Vitamin A, RAE | 9.0 | UG |
| Vitamin E (alpha-tocopherol) | 0.64 | MG |
| Vitamin D (D2 + D3) | 0.10 | UG |
| Vitamin K (phylloquinone) | 0 | UG |
| Calcium, Ca | 11.0 | MG |
| Iron, Fe | 0.46 | MG |
| Magnesium, Mg | 16.0 | MG |
| Phosphorus, P | 123 | MG |
| Potassium, K | 187 | MG |
| Sodium, Na | 84.0 | MG |
| Zinc, Zn | 1.2 | MG |
| Copper, Cu | 0.03 | MG |
| Manganese, Mn | 0.01 | MG |
| Selenium, Se | 17.6 | UG |
